Michael Duke Obituary

Michael John Duke, 31 of Montclair, NJ was called to the Lord on Sunday, October 7, 2018. Michael was the loving husband and best friend of Andrea Barry Duke, formerly of Dover, DE. Michael was Born February 7, 1987 in Darby, PA, he was the son of Ann Del Grippo Duke and the late Michael C. Duke, and step-son of William Long III. In 2005, Michael graduated from Salesianum High School where he was an All-State Lacrosse player and a member of the National Honor Society. He graduated Magna cum laude from Villanova University in December 2008 and began a successful career as a securities trader in New York City. In early 2018, Michael was named the Director of Securitized Trading at Int’l FC Stone. Michael was a dedicated son, brother, husband and especially a loving father. He truly cherished his time spent with his daughter, Emma. Michael enjoyed fishing, playing golf, hunting, his bulldog Reggie, and was a true Eagles fan to the core. In addition to his wife, Andrea, and mother, Ann, he is survived by his daughter, Emma Cecelia Duke, his sisters Claire Duke Levy (Kevin), Martha Cecelia Duke, and Elizabeth Ann Duke; his step brothers, William Long IV (Hannah), Jeffrey Long (Emily), and stepsister, Jessica Long; In-laws Edwin and Jeannie Barry and brother-in-law Matt Barry. He is also survived by three nephews, Liam Long, Christopher Levy, and William Long, V and grandmother Cecilia Duke and step-grandparents William Long Jr. and Regina Long.
